Output 85150abc52dadc7e49b15826afd6e660cbcdc08fb0fc52d459a068f69f647dbc:4

value
2389412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75ef4259bbe41a0191b8d60c41c4a211596c1700 OP_EQUAL
address
3CSbc1Nodcg4Gj9Ga1Tbi6jfXopLZN2YMb
transaction
85150abc52dadc7e49b15826afd6e660cbcdc08fb0fc52d459a068f69f647dbc
confirmations
166105
spent
true